Step 1 The first time your doctor prescribes a medication
that you will take on a regular basis, ask for two prescriptions.

The first prescription should be written for a one-month supply that
can be immediately filled at a participating retail pharmacy.


The second prescription should be written for a 90-day supply of the
medication with refills.


Use the 90-day prescription to obtain your medication from the mail order
pharmacy.


The mail order pharmacy cannot alter your prescription, which must be
dispensed as written by your doctor. You will be charged according to your
pharmacy benefit for any prescription you submit to the mail order pharmacy.


Step 2 Use the process that is most convenient for you to
fill mail order prescriptions:


FAX — Give your doctor your ID number. Then have your doctor call
1-888-327-9791 for instructions about how to fax your prescription to the
pharmacy. Prescription Fax Forms are available at www.uhcrivervalley.com but
must be faxed in by your doctor.


MAIL — Mail the completed Medco By Mail Order Form and
the Health, Allergy and
Medication Questionnaire
, along with your prescription. The information you
supply on this questionnaire is kept confidential and helps the pharmacist check
for potential medication interactions. Forms are also available by calling the
Customer Care number on your ID card. Mail completed forms and your prescription
to the address on the mail order form.


Step 3 Pay for your prescription.


You can pay by check, money order or credit card. To enroll for e-check
payments, set up an automated payment plan using a credit card and price
medications, log in to www.uhcrivervalley.com or call 1-800-948-8779.


We promptly deliver your order in a package that doesn’t indicate the
contents. Your prescription order will be delivered to you within seven to 11
days. Your package will include a medication container, refill instructions and
information about your medication.
